The University of Oklahoma College of Dentistry is seeking a Senior Dental Assistant to join our Graduate Orthodontics team. This position provides chair side dental assistance prepares and sterilizes equipment documents patient care takes and develops x-rays along with provides administrative assistance.

Duties:

  • Assists the dentist during a variety of treatment procedures to include but not limited to placement of bases and liners and placement and removal of rubber dams insertion finishing and removal of temporary restorations.
  • Prepares set-up trays for anesthetic operative prosthetic periodontal prophylactic endodontic and orthodontic dentistry. Prepares dental equipment and materials for treatment.
  • Takes and develops dental radiographs (x-rays).
  • Performs patient charting as instructed by the dentist.
  • Follows infection control protocol and prepares and sterilizes instruments and equipment.
  • Greets patient and gets them situated in the treatment room.
  • Provides patients with instructions for oral care following surgery or other dental treatment procedures.
  • Takes impressions of patients teeth for study casts (models of teeth).
  • May perform office management tasks that often require the use of a personal computer. Schedules appointments answers phones data entry and orders supplies.
  • Performs various duties as needed to successfully fulfill the functions of the position.

Required Education: High School Diploma or GED AND:

  • 24 months experience performing chair side dental assistance.

Equivalency Substitution: Certified Dental Assistant (CDA) is equivalent to 12 months experience.

Skills:

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to follow outlined policies and guidelines.
  • Ability to provide patient care and customer service.
  • Ability to multitask
  • Must have a professional and positive attitude.

Certifications:

  • Required to have 2 of the 4 Certifications from Oklahoma Board of Dentistry: Radiation Protection and Safety Coronal Polishing and Topical Fluoride Placement of Pit and Fissure Sealants Assisting in the Administration of Nitrous Oxide
  • CPR/BLS Certification

Advertised Physical Requirements:

  • Physical:
    • Standing for long periods of time.
    • Manual dexterity.
    • Speaking listening walking and reaching.
  • Environmental:
    • Clinic Environment.
    • Exposure to infectious diseases and blood borne pathogens.
